3) Calculating the wattage of each actuator that can be connected to a single-phase specification system
For LSA (Linear Actuator) and DD (Direct Drive Motor) to connect to the single phase type, calculate the
wattage from “Output for controller wattage calculation” in the table below.
Also, make selection to have the total wattage of LSA, DD and other actuators at 1600W or less.
1600W ≥ LSA Total wattage of LSAs (Output for controller wattage calculation × Number of axes) + Wattage
of DD (Output for controller wattage calculation) + Wattage of other actuators (Motor wattage × Number of
axes)
